MySQL存储过程运行错误:问题定位与修正方案

原创 小咪咪 2025-01-22 16:06 60阅读 0赞

在MySQL中,存储过程(Procedure)如果出现运行错误,通常可以按照以下步骤进行问题定位和修正:

  1. 错误信息分析

    • 查看MySQL日志(error.log),这里会记录到的存储过程错误详情。
    • 如果是英文提示,尝试使用在线翻译工具帮助理解。
  2. 调用存储过程

    • 在命令行或开发环境里,重复执行导致错误的操作,以便重现问题。
  3. 检查参数和变量

    • 检查调用存储过程时使用的参数和变量是否正确。
    • 如果是动态生成的SQL,确保SQL语句没有语法错误。
  4. 权限问题

    • 确保运行该存储过程的用户有足够的权限。
  5. 更新MySQL版本

    • 如果以上步骤都无法解决问题,可能是由于MySQL版本的问题。尝试升级或降级MySQL版本到一个已知不会存在问题的版本。

记住在修正错误之前,备份数据库是非常重要的。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,60人围观)

还没有评论,来说两句吧...

相关阅读